What Causes Popcorn Lung-Bronchiolitis Obliterans? Bronchiolitis obliterans, also known as "Popcorn Lung," occurs when the lungs' air sacs (alveoli) become scarred. Specifically, the bronchioles (the small lung airway) become scarred and do not enable adequate airflow. E-Cig Flavoring, Battery Voltage Associated with Cellular Damage, Study Shows
A new study suggests that the flavorings in e-cigarettes are associated with damage at the cellular level. Researchers from Roswell Park Cancer Institute in Buffalo, New York published findings online in the BMJ journal Tobacco Control showing that some flavors were more harmful than others.
